1 The origin of sexual reproduction: 1.2-2 billion years ago. The first fossilized evidence of sexual reproduction in eukaryotes comes from the red algae Bangiomorpha pubescens, dated to approximately 1.2 billion years ago (Butterfield 2000, Paleobiology). This organism shows two distinct reproductive cell types, one sexual and one asexual — the earliest preserved evidence of sexual differentiation. True sexual reproduction, however, likely evolved earlier in the Last Eukaryotic Common Ancestor (LECA), estimated at 1.5-2 billion years ago, as evidenced by the widespread presence of meiosis and gamete fusion across all major eukaryotic lineages. The significance: everything more complex than a bacterium — every plant, animal, fungus, and protist — descends from this first sexual ancestor. Prokaryotes (bacteria, archaea) largely reproduce asexually and remain simple. Eukaryotes adopted sex and became complex. Sexual reproduction and biological complexity are not coincidentally correlated; they are causally related. Source: Butterfield NJ. 2 The two-fold cost of sex: measured, not theorised, at 2.14x. John Maynard Smith identified what he called the two-fold cost of males: in a sexually reproducing population, half the individuals are males who cannot themselves produce offspring. An asexual female produces twice as many reproductive offspring per generation as a sexual female. This fitness disadvantage is theoretically 2.0x. Howard and Lively (Nature, 1994) showed through computational simulation that parasitism and mutation accumulation together create an advantage to sex beyond what either factor produces alone. Crucially, Lively et al.’s landmark field study measured the two-fold cost directly in real outdoor populations across four breeding seasons. The maximum likelihood estimate: 2.14. Not approximated, not modelled. Measured. Evolution maintained sex despite a 2.14-fold fitness disadvantage. Whatever sex provides, it provides it to a value greater than 2.14x asexual reproduction. 3 The neuroscience of romantic love: addiction, obsession, and the VTA. Helen Fisher of Rutgers University (later Indiana University) and colleagues conducted the foundational fMRI studies of romantic love, studying 17 people intensely in love (Aron et al. 2005, J Neurophysiol 94:327-337). The neural activation specific to the beloved occurred in the RIGHT VENTRAL TEGMENTAL AREA (VTA) and RIGHT CAUDATE NUCLEUS — dopamine-rich areas associated with mammalian reward and motivation. These are the same circuits activated by cocaine and opioids. A 2025 Journal of Psychiatry Spectrum review confirmed Fisher’s findings show ‘activation akin to the brain activity displayed when someone is addicted to opioids and cocaine.’ Marazziti et al. (1999) found that new lovers’ serotonin transporter densities are statistically identical to patients with obsessive-compulsive disorder, explaining the obsessive rumination that characterises new love. The neurological state of ‘being in love’ is, precisely and literally, a form of temporary neural addiction. Source: Aron et al. J Neurophysiol 2005; Fisher et al. 5 The Kamasutra as philosophical text: what most people have never been told. The Kamasutra of Vatsyayana (approximately 3rd century CE, though possibly incorporating older material) contains approximately 1,250 verses across seven books. The common image of the Kamasutra as a sexual technique manual is a profound mischaracterisation. Books 1 (Sadharana — general principles and education), 3 (Kanya Samprayuktaka — on approaching girls and courtship), 4 (Bharya — on the wife), 5 (Paradararika — on other men’s wives), 6 (Vaishika — on courtesans), and 7 (Aupanishadika — on occult and practical matters) together account for approximately 80% of the text and deal with social conduct, psychology of attraction, ethics of relationship, education in the arts, and the philosophy of Kama within the Purushartha framework. The explicitly sexual Book 2 (Samprayogika) represents approximately 20% of the text. Vatsyayana’s governing argument: a person educated in Kama is a more complete human being. Desire is not to be denied but to be cultured, like any other human faculty. Source: Kamasutra, Vatsyayana; Doniger W & Kakar S translation 2002.
6 Khajuraho and Konark: the architectural programme of desire toward the divine. The erotic sculptures of Khajuraho (Madhya Pradesh, 10th-12th century CE, Chandela dynasty) and the Sun Temple at Konark (Odisha, 13th century CE, Eastern Ganga dynasty) have been variously interpreted as tantric instruction, as royal legitimacy displays, as fertility magic, and as simply decorative. The most architecturally coherent interpretation is the one supported by temple structure: the erotic carvings appear almost exclusively on the outer walls (the outermost ring of the temple complex), representing the realm of worldly life including Kama. As the devotee progresses inward through the temple — through the vestibule, the hall, the sanctuary — the figures become progressively less worldly and more abstract. The innermost sanctum (garbhagriha) is entirely plain. The architectural programme says: this is where you begin (Kama, outer world), this is where you end (Moksha, the empty inner sanctum). Sexuality is not excluded from the sacred journey; it is its first threshold. To enter the temple is to acknowledge that you begin here — in desire — and move through and beyond it. 1. The Most Ancient Fire — When Life First Invented Sex and Why Everything Changed

Before the dinosaurs. Before the fish. Before the first multicellular organism assembled itself from a community of cells that decided not to separate. Before any of this, there was a moment in the shallow waters of the Proterozoic sea when chemistry became biology’s most audacious experiment.

For approximately the first two billion years of life on Earth, organisms reproduced by copying themselves. Bacteria split. Archaea divided. Each daughter cell was a near-perfect replica of its parent. This is a perfectly functional strategy — bacteria are still doing it today, 3.7 billion years later, and they’re quite good at it. But it has a fundamental limitation: every offspring is essentially the same organism. When a new threat arrives — a virus, a temperature change, a new predator — the entire population is equally vulnerable. If the threat can crack one individual’s defences, it can crack everyone’s.

Around 1.5 to 2 billion years ago, in the organism we call the Last Eukaryotic Common Ancestor, something unprecedented occurred: the development of meiosis, the capacity to produce gametes (cells containing only half the normal genetic complement), and the ability of two gametes to fuse and combine their genetic material into a new individual with a unique combination of genetic information. The first fossilized evidence of this event is Bangiomorpha pubescens, a red algae from approximately 1.2 billion years ago, showing two distinct cell types: sexual and asexual reproductive cells in the same organism.

This was the first act of desire in the history of life. And it was catastrophically expensive.

Why sex should have died immediately

John Maynard Smith’s calculation of the two-fold cost of males is brutal in its simplicity. In a clonal population, every individual can produce offspring. In a sexual population, half the individuals are male — metabolically costly, reproductively dependent on females, and unable to produce offspring independently. An asexual female that arose by mutation in a sexual population would immediately produce twice as many reproducing offspring per generation as her sexual neighbours. Within a few generations, she and her descendants should have driven the sexual population to extinction. This isn’t a theoretical problem. Field researchers measured the two-fold cost directly across four breeding seasons and found it to be 2.14 — not 2.0 as theorised, but 2.14 as measured. Sex should not exist. It is objectively more expensive than its alternative. And yet sex persists in 99% of eukaryotic species.

The Red Queen hypothesis is the most compelling answer. In Lewis Carroll’s Through the Looking Glass, the Red Queen tells Alice: ‘Now here, you see, it takes all the running you can do to keep in the same place.’ Parasites — viruses, bacteria, fungi, protozoans — are perpetually evolving to crack the genetic defences of their hosts. A clonal host population gives parasites a fixed target: crack one individual’s lock and every individual is vulnerable. A sexual population shuffles the genetic deck with every generation, constantly changing the locks. The parasites that can crack this generation’s defences will find next generation’s entirely reconfigured. The 2025 Ebert review in the Annual Review of Genetics confirmed that Red Queen dynamics visible across days match patterns traceable across millions of years of evolutionary time.

Sex is life’s insurance against the enemy that evolves every generation. You and I exist because of parasites. Our lineages are here because, 1.2 billion years ago, the first sexual organism was better at evading infection than its asexual neighbour. That’s the oldest reason for desire. And it’s still running in every immune cell in your body.

Sex is life’s most expensive experiment and its most successful innovation. It shouldn’t exist by the arithmetic. It persists because nothing else works as well. 2. How Life Learned to Advertise Desire — From Pollen Clouds to Peacock Feathers to Human Concealments

Having invented sex, life immediately had a new problem: how do you find another organism of your species, convince it to mate with you rather than a competitor, and ensure that the resulting offspring gets the best possible genetic combination?

The first solution was the shotgun approach. Ancient gymnosperms — the conifers, ginkgos, and cycads that dominated the Mesozoic world — released pollen in unimaginable quantities into the wind. A single pine tree releases billions of pollen grains in a season, each one essentially a male gamete broadcast blindly into the air in the statistical hope that a few will land on a receptive female cone. Walk through a pine forest in spring and the air turns yellow. This is sex — inefficient, imprecise, profligate, but functional.

The flower: the first deliberate sexual advertisement in evolutionary history

Approximately 130 million years ago, angiosperms — the flowering plants — appeared and within a remarkably short evolutionary period came to dominate land plant ecology. The key innovation: instead of broadcasting gametes randomly, they engineered intermediaries to carry pollen precisely where it needed to go. The flower is evolution’s first deliberate sexual advertisement.

Think about what a flower actually is. The colour is calibrated to the visual spectrum of its target pollinator — red for hummingbirds (who see red well), ultraviolet patterns for bees (who see UV, which humans cannot). The scent is a chemical broadcast specifically designed to attract and orient the target pollinator. The shape of the flower is engineered to deposit pollen on the pollinator’s body at exactly the position where it will transfer to the next flower’s stigma. The nectar is a reward payment for carrying services rendered. The entire structure is a sexual service agreement between plant and animal, refined across millions of years of co-evolution.

The orchid’s sexual deception is the most astonishing example. Multiple orchid species across the genus Ophrys produce chemical signatures that precisely mimic the sex pheromones of female bees, wasps, and flies. The male insect, chemically convinced he has found a receptive female, attempts to mate with the flower. No nectar is offered as payment — the entire transaction is the insect’s sexual frustration harnessed for plant reproduction. The orchid gets its pollen transported. The bee gets nothing. It has been happening for millions of years.

The fig and the fig wasp go further: 80 million years of mutual co-evolution so intimate that neither can reproduce without the other. The female fig wasp enters a fig through a tiny opening, losing her wings in the process. She lays her eggs in some of the fig’s flowers and pollinates others. Her offspring develop inside the fig. Male wasps are born, mate with female wasps before they emerge, and die inside the fig. Female wasps emerge with pollen, find a new fig, and repeat the cycle. The fig produces no offspring without the wasp. The wasp produces no offspring without the fig. They are, reproductively speaking, the same organism.

The animal escalation: display, cost, and the peacock’s unspeakable tail

In the animal world, sexual advertisement became an arms race. Charles Darwin was troubled by the peacock’s tail to the point of nausea. ‘The sight of a feather in a peacock’s tail, whenever I gaze at it, makes me sick!’ he wrote, because the tail makes the peacock slower, heavier, more visible to predators, and requires enormous nutritional resources to grow and maintain. It is, by every measure except female preference, a catastrophic liability. And yet peahens prefer peacocks with more elaborate tails. And so the tail gets more elaborate every generation.

Amotz Zahavi’s handicap principle solved Darwin’s problem: an elaborate display that is genuinely costly is precisely what makes it honest. A peacock that can grow an enormous, energetically expensive, predator-attracting tail and still survive long enough to display it is demonstrating genetic quality that a competitor cannot fake. The display is expensive because it has to be. Cheap signals can be counterfeited. Only the costly ones are reliable indicators of genuine fitness. Every elaborate animal display — the humpback whale’s 20-minute song that travels 1,000 kilometres, the bower bird’s meticulous construction of an architectural courtship display, the salmon’s extraordinary physiological transformation and upstream journey to its spawning ground where it will die — is governed by the same logic: spend everything you have to demonstrate that you have everything to give.

The human exception: four changes that made sexuality the centre of everything

Among all living primates, humans made four evolutionary choices that transformed sexuality from a seasonal biological function into the central axis of human social organisation.

Concealed ovulation: female chimpanzees advertise their fertile periods with dramatic perineal swelling visible from a distance. Human females have no such signal. Human males cannot determine from external inspection whether a female partner is fertile. This seemingly simple change had enormous social consequences: a male human cannot maximise his reproductive success by only engaging sexually when his partner is fertile, because he cannot know when she is fertile. The only strategy available is continuous, long-term exclusive partnership. Concealed ovulation is one of the primary evolutionary drivers of pair bonding.

Year-round receptivity: female mammals outside humans are sexually receptive only during oestrus — the relatively brief fertile window. Human females are physiologically capable of sexual activity at any point in their cycle. This makes sexual activity available as a mechanism for social bonding, conflict resolution, and relationship maintenance entirely independently of its reproductive function.

Pair bonding: the long-term cross-sex partnership with at least the social norm of sexual exclusivity is unusual in primates. It requires ongoing sexual attraction across time, emotional investment in a specific individual, and the complex social and psychological architecture of jealousy, trust, commitment, and betrayal that occupies so much of human emotional and creative life.

Recreational sex: humans engage in sexual activity throughout pregnancy, during phases of the cycle when reproduction is impossible, and increasingly through methods that prevent conception entirely. Sex has become, in the human case, a social technology — a tool for bonding, communication, stress relief, pleasure, and spiritual practice — as much as or more than a reproductive mechanism. No other species uses sexuality with this breadth of non-reproductive purpose.

4. The Neuroscience and Psychology of Desire — Why It Is So Demanding

Why is sex so demanding?’ is your question. The neurological answer is precise and may be the most important thing any educated person could understand about their own psychology.

The brain has two systems that people often confuse as one: the wanting system and the liking system. They are neurologically distinct, anatomically separate, and capable of operating in dramatically different and even opposite directions.

Wanting and liking: the neural split that explains everything

Kent Berridge’s research at the University of Michigan, conducted over three decades, established this distinction definitively. WANTING is driven by dopamine in the nucleus accumbens. It produces the craving, the seeking, the urgency, the fixation on the object of desire. LIKING is driven by opioid systems (endorphins and enkephalins) in specific ‘hedonic hotspots’ in the nucleus accumbens and ventral pallidum. It produces pleasure, satisfaction, the felt goodness of the experience.

Here’s the clinical nightmare: you can WANT something intensely without particularly LIKING it. The dopamine wanting system can be activated to almost any intensity by the right cue — a smell, a sound, an image, a memory. The opioid liking system responds to the actual experience. And crucially, dopamine sensitisation (which happens in addiction) can make wanting escalate while liking remains flat or even declines. The addict wants the drug desperately and derives diminishing pleasure from it. The same dynamic is observable in compulsive sexual behaviour.

This is why sexual desire is so demanding: it is primarily driven by the dopamine wanting system, which is ancient, powerful, and essentially insatiable. The wanting system was shaped by evolution to be never fully satisfied — because an organism that stops wanting stops seeking, and an organism that stops seeking stops reproducing. The wanting was designed to be permanent. Only the object can temporarily satisfy it.

Helen Fisher: love is an addiction

Helen Fisher, the biological anthropologist whose fMRI studies of romantic love are the most cited in the field, was asked once what she would do if she could develop a medication to extinguish the pain of romantic rejection. Her answer: she would never take it. Because the same circuits that produce the devastation of romantic loss produce the ecstasy of new love, and she wasn’t willing to give up the second to escape the first.

Fisher’s studies of 17 people intensely in love showed activation specific to the beloved in the right ventral tegmental area and right caudate nucleus — dopamine-rich reward circuits. The same study examined people recently rejected in romantic relationships and found activation in the same VTA, in the insular cortex (associated with physical pain), and in the anterior cingulate cortex (associated with social pain and the subjective experience of hurt). Heartbreak lights up the same brain regions as a broken bone. This is not metaphor. It is neurology.

Marazziti et al.’s 1999 research found something even more striking: people who had fallen in love within the previous six months showed serotonin transporter densities statistically indistinguishable from patients diagnosed with obsessive-compulsive disorder. The obsessive quality of new love — the inability to think about anything else, the repeated return to thoughts of the beloved, the preoccupation that makes normal functioning difficult — is chemically identical to OCD. This is not a flaw in how we love. It’s a feature. The obsession ensures the motivation to pursue the bond to its establishment. Once the bond is established, serotonin systems normalise.

The Coolidge Effect: why novelty resets the system

The Coolidge Effect is named after a joke about President Calvin Coolidge, but the phenomenon it describes is one of the most consistent findings in reproductive biology. When a male animal who has mated with a female to the point of sexual satiation is presented with a new, receptive female, sexual motivation is immediately restored. The sexual satiation was not about exhaustion; it was about habituation to the specific partner. Novelty resets it.

This effect has been documented in every mammal species tested, including rats, rabbits, sheep, cattle, and humans. It has a clear evolutionary logic: in an environment where mating with multiple females increases reproductive success, the male who remains motivated by novelty out-reproduces the male who is satisfied with one. But in the context of human pair bonding, the Coolidge Effect creates a structural tension: the very feature that made our male ancestors reproductively successful creates a persistent appetite for novelty that conflicts with the social value of long-term fidelity.

Understanding the Coolidge Effect doesn’t excuse behaviour. It explains it. And explaining it is the precondition for managing it consciously rather than pretending it doesn’t exist.

Supernormal stimuli: the pornography problem

Nikolaas Tinbergen’s concept of the supernormal stimulus, developed in the 1950s and earning him the Nobel Prize in 1973, describes what happens when an animal is exposed to an exaggerated version of a stimulus that evolved to trigger a specific behaviour. A bird will preferentially incubate a giant plaster egg over her own real egg, because the larger egg triggers her brooding instinct more strongly than the egg she actually laid. The stimulus is fake, but the response is real and compulsive.

Pornography is the supernormal sexual stimulus. It presents sexual imagery with a frequency, variety, physical idealization, and accessibility that has no parallel in the ancestral environment. The brain’s sexual reward circuits, calibrated for the relatively rare occurrence of sexual opportunity in the ancestral world, are presented with essentially unlimited sexual stimulation on demand. The predictable consequences: dopamine sensitisation, tolerance (requiring more extreme material for the same arousal level), and habituation to real partners (who cannot compete with the exaggerated stimuli the dopamine system has been calibrated to respond to).

Gary Wilson’s 2012 book ‘Your Brain on Porn’ and Norman Doidge’s ‘The Brain That Changes Itself’ documented what neuroimaging research subsequently confirmed: pornography produces measurable changes in prefrontal cortex connectivity, reward circuit sensitivity, and partnered sexual function in heavy users. These are not moral claims. They are neurological observations. 5. Indian Philosophy’s Complete Framework — Kama, Kamasutra, Temple Art, and Brahmacharya Correctly Understood

The Indian philosophical tradition is the most sophisticated engagement with sexuality that any civilisation has produced. This is not romanticism. It’s a factual assessment based on comparative examination of what different traditions have actually said and built.

It is the only tradition that placed sexuality as a formal, legitimate dimension of the complete human life. Not as a concession to weakness. As one of four co-equal life goals.

The three debts and the divine obligation to reproduce

Ancient Indian philosophy describes the human being as born with three debts: Rishi Rina (debt to the sages, repaid through study and the transmission of knowledge), Deva Rina (debt to the gods, repaid through ritual and devotion), and Pitru Rina (debt to the ancestors, repaid through reproduction). The third debt makes biological reproduction a cosmic obligation — the continuity of the lineage, the ongoing experiment of consciousness in embodied form, is the responsibility of every human who has received the gift of a human birth.

This is a radically different moral framework from those traditions that treat reproduction as a regrettable but tolerated consequence of desire. In the Indian framework, reproduction is duty. Sexuality in service of this duty is not merely permitted but required. The householder (Grihastha) who fulfils this obligation, who maintains the household, raises children, feeds students and ascetics, supports the social fabric — is performing one of the highest forms of dharmic service available to a human being.

The four Purusharthas: where Kama lives

The four Purusharthas are the four legitimate goals of human life: Dharma (right conduct, righteousness), Artha (material prosperity and security), Kama (desire, pleasure, and love), and Moksha (liberation from the cycle of rebirth). These are not a hierarchy where the later items are superior to the earlier ones. They are co-equal dimensions of the complete human life.

Kama as Purushartha means desire is a valid life goal in itself. Not desire as indulgence or desire as compulsion, but desire as a dimension of full human experience that has its own dignity and its own proper cultivation. The Chandogya Upanishad’s statement that the Grihastha — the householder who lives fully in the world including in sexual relationship — is the highest of the four ashramas, is not an accommodation. It’s a philosophical position: embodied human life in its fullness, including its sexual dimension, is one of the most sacred things available to a conscious being.

Kamasutra: the philosophical education in desire

Vatsyayana’s governing argument, stated in the text’s opening section, is that a person educated in all three of Dharma, Artha, and Kama simultaneously and without conflict between them is the ideal human being. Kama is not opposed to Dharma. It is required to be practiced within Dharma. The text is not permission for desire. It is a discipline of desire.

The Kamasutra begins with chapters on the cultivation of the arts — music, poetry, drawing, decorating, games, the preparation of perfumes. These are not preliminary chapters before the ‘real’ material. They are the first stage of the sexual education the text prescribes: the person who has cultivated sensory refinement, aesthetic appreciation, and the ability to give and receive pleasure at multiple levels is the person who will practice Kama with genuine intelligence.

The text’s understanding of the psychology of attraction is modern enough to be startling: Vatsyayana distinguishes between physical attraction, attraction based on character and intelligence, and attachment based on shared experience. He discusses the approach and courtship process in terms that modern relationship psychology would recognise: the importance of genuine attention, the signalling of interest without desperation, the specific architecture of emotional safety within which desire can deepen. The Kamasutra is not a sex manual. It is a textbook in the psychology of attraction, relationship, and the cultivation of erotic intelligence as a dimension of full human development.

Khajuraho and Konark: the temple that teaches by location

The erotic carvings at Khajuraho are placed on the outer walls — the most outward ring of the sacred space, the boundary between the temple and the world. This is not arbitrary. It is the architectural embodiment of a philosophical proposition: the world you come from is the world of Kama. The desire that drives human existence is real, valid, sacred in its own way — and it is where the journey to the divine begins.

As you enter the temple, moving from outer to inner, the imagery changes. The erotic figures of the outer walls give way to figures of devotees, then to attendant deities, then to the main deity in the vestibule, and finally to the entirely empty, entirely dark, entirely plain garbhagriha — the womb-chamber at the temple’s heart where only the bare divine symbol (the Shivalinga or the abstract form) is present.

The message: you start in desire. You end in the silence beyond all desire. But you don’t skip the first stage. You don’t pretend it isn’t where you are. You acknowledge it, honour it, and let it be the beginning of the journey rather than the obstacle to it. The Khajuraho temple doesn’t exclude Kama from the sacred. It maps the path from Kama to Moksha.

Brahmacharya: the most misunderstood concept in Indian philosophy

Sanskrit: Brahma (ultimate consciousness, the ground of all being) + charya (moving in, living in, practising). Brahmacharya is literally ‘living in the movement of Brahman’ or ‘moving in the direction of the ultimate consciousness.’ It is not, in its original meaning, celibacy as the Christian tradition understands it: virtue achieved through the suppression of desire.

The Bhagavad Gita’s declaration in Chapter 7, verse 11: ‘Dharmavirodhah bhuteshu Kamo’smi Bharatarshabha’ — ‘I am the desire that is not opposed to Dharma, O Arjuna.’ Krishna, the divine, explicitly identifies himself with desire. Not all desire — desire that conflicts with Dharma is not divine. But Dharmic desire is, in the Gita’s own terms, the divine speaking through the body. Brahmacharya, therefore, is not the elimination of desire but the alignment of desire with the divine quality of Brahman.

What this means practically: a householder who engages in sexual relationship within the bounds of Dharma (within commitment, within mutual respect, oriented toward life and love rather than exploitation and depletion) is practising Brahmacharya. And the ascetic who conserves sexual energy for spiritual practice is also practising Brahmacharya. The common denominator is consciousness: knowing what you’re doing, why you’re doing it, and whether it serves the direction of expansion or the direction of depletion.

The question Indian philosophy asks is not ‘should I suppress my desire?’ It asks: ‘what will I make with this fire?’ Sexual energy is creative energy at its most primal. The artist, the philosopher, the mystic, and the lover are using the same fire. The difference is the direction. Brahmacharya is the practice of knowing the direction.

6. Why Religions Controlled Women — The Sexual Power Question Most Traditions Refuse to Answer

No honest examination of sexuality in human culture can avoid this question: why, across virtually every major religious tradition and most historical cultures, have women’s sexual autonomy and social freedom been more restricted than men’s? And specifically: does sexuality have a role in this restriction?

The honest answer is: yes, decisively and primarily. And the mechanism is biological before it is spiritual.

The paternity certainty problem: the biological root of patriarchal restriction

Before DNA testing — which became clinically available only in the 1980s — there was no way for a male human to know with certainty whether a child was his. Women always know. A woman knows which child she carried and delivered. A man, throughout the entire span of human evolutionary and cultural history, could only infer paternity from circumstances.

For a male in a system of patrilineal inheritance — where property, status, and lineage pass through the male line — this creates an existential threat. Investing in a child who is not genetically yours is, from an evolutionary perspective, the worst possible use of your reproductive resources. It is not merely wasteful; it actively benefits your genetic competitor. The psychological mechanisms of jealousy, mate-guarding, and the specific form of distress men show in response to female sexual infidelity (which neuroimaging research shows is neurologically more distressing to men than emotional infidelity, in contrast to the reverse for women) are evolutionary adaptations to this problem.

The social and institutional solution was the control of female sexual access. If women’s sexual autonomy is restricted — through veiling, through seclusion, through marriage as property transfer, through honour codes that enforce female virginity — then paternity becomes more certain, and the male’s investment in children is more reliably directed toward his own genetic offspring. Religion became the enforcement mechanism because religion has the authority to define not just law but moral reality: what is right, what is sin, what is honoured and what is shamed.

Buddhism: the monk, the woman, and the spiritual threat

The historical Buddha’s resistance to establishing an order of female monastics is one of the most debated passages in Buddhist literature. According to the Pali Canon, when his aunt Mahapajapati Gotami requested the establishment of a bhikkhuni (female monk) order, the Buddha initially declined three times. It was only through Ananda’s repeated advocacy that the order was eventually established — with the Eight Garudhammas (heavy duties) that placed every nun, regardless of her seniority, subordinate to every monk, regardless of his.

The Buddha’s stated reason included the claim that the presence of women in the sangha would shorten the lifespan of the Dharma from 1,000 to 500 years. Scholars have debated whether this passage is authentic or later insertion. What is clear is that the restriction of female monasticism reflected the community’s anxiety about female sexuality’s perceived threat to male contemplative celibacy. The problem was not women’s spiritual capacity — the texts contain numerous accounts of female arhants and enlightened women. The problem was the disruption of male brahmacharya in the presence of female bodies.

Jainism: the body question and liberation

The Jain schism between Digambara and Shvetambara traditions has at its heart a dispute about female bodies and liberation. The Digambara tradition holds that complete renunciation includes the renunciation of clothing — the sky-clad monks are living the complete non-possessiveness that Jain ethics requires. The tradition also holds that women cannot achieve liberation (Moksha) in a female body, because a female body cannot practice the complete nudity that Digambara monkhood requires — a concession to female modesty and to the protection of women’s bodies from male gaze that is simultaneously a theological limitation on women’s liberation capacity.

The Shvetambara tradition disagrees: women can achieve liberation in a female body, and the 19th Tirthankara, Malli (Mallinatha in Shvetambara tradition), was a woman. The philosophical dispute over whether liberation is achievable in a female body is ultimately a dispute about whether the female body — understood as inherently associated with sexuality and reproduction — is compatible with the highest spiritual attainment.

Islam and the architecture of purdah

The hijab, niqab, and purdah traditions in Islamic culture are direct responses to the concept of fitna — the social chaos that uncontrolled sexual attraction was believed to produce. The Quranic injunctions to cover and to lower the gaze are not primarily about female modesty in the sense of personal virtue; they are about social management of sexual desire and its potential to disrupt the community’s (ummah’s) cohesion and the family’s purity of lineage.

The specific architecture of female restriction — domestic seclusion, male guardianship (mahram), restrictions on public presence and movement, requirements for consent to marriage through a male guardian (wali) — served multiple functions: protection of women from sexual violence in public spaces (a genuine concern in historical contexts), enforcement of the social hierarchy, and, critically, the management of paternity certainty in a system of patrilineal inheritance and strict lineage purity.

Christianity: the body as sin, the woman as temptress

The Christian treatment of female sexuality draws on multiple sources: the Genesis narrative (Eve as the agent of the Fall through whom sexual knowledge entered human experience), Pauline theology (Paul’s famous statements about marriage as ‘better to marry than to burn,’ framing marriage as a concession to sexual desire rather than an intrinsic good), and Augustine’s theology of original sin (transmitted specifically through the act of sexual intercourse). The cumulative effect was to associate female sexuality specifically with spiritual danger: woman as temptress, the body as a prison of the soul, and sexual abstinence as the ideal state.

The consequences were centuries of theological restriction of female autonomy in Christian societies, the association of female sexual independence with heresy and witchcraft (the witch trial literature is substantially about the sexual behaviour of the accused), and the Mary-Eve binary: the only good women are asexual (Mary, the virgin mother) or repentant former sinners (Mary Magdalene). Ordinary women with ordinary sexual desires were the theological problem.

This is not anti-religious polemic. Every tradition named here also contains extraordinary women, sophisticated female thinkers, and traditions of female spiritual authority that complicate these patterns. The point is not that religion hates women. The point is that one of religion’s consistent historical functions — across cultures, traditions, and centuries — has been the management of female sexuality in service of patrilineal social order. Understanding this is not a criticism. It’s history.

7. Liberal Versus Strict Societies — What the Data Actually Shows About Sexual Education and Freedom

The most significant natural experiment in sexual culture is ongoing right now, distributed across the democratic world: societies with vastly different approaches to sex education, sexual freedom, and the cultural treatment of sexuality, all with measurable health outcomes that make comparison possible.

The Netherlands: the most studied case for comprehensive sex education

The Netherlands introduced ‘Spring Fever’ — a comprehensive sexuality education curriculum — beginning in primary schools in the 1990s. The current framework introduces basic concepts of bodies, reproduction, and relationships at age 4, progressively building toward comprehensive information about contraception, STI prevention, consent, gender identity, and relationship health through secondary school. The cultural context is also permissive: the Netherlands has legal, regulated sex work, widely available contraception without prescription, and a social norm of open discussion of sexuality within families.

The outcomes: teenage pregnancy rate of approximately 4-5 per 1,000 women aged 15-19, among the lowest in the developed world. STI rates that are comparable to or lower than more conservative European nations. Rates of reported sexual violence that are not distinctly higher than more restrictive societies. The average age of first sexual intercourse in the Netherlands (approximately 17.1 years) is not lower than in more conservative countries — comprehensive sex education does not accelerate sexual initiation. It produces better decision-making when sexual initiation occurs.

The United States: the abstinence-only experiment

Between 1996 and 2010, the United States federal government spent approximately $1.5 billion on abstinence-only sex education programmes, based on the premise that teaching about contraception and sexual activity would increase teenage sexual activity. The scientific evaluation of these programmes found consistently: abstinence-only education did not delay sexual initiation, did not reduce rates of teenage pregnancy, and produced adolescents less likely to use contraception when they did become sexually active — increasing their risk of both pregnancy and STI.

The United States’ teen pregnancy rate (approximately 17-22 per 1,000 women aged 15-19 across the relevant period) is 3-5 times higher than the Netherlands’, despite comparable levels of affluence and development. States with the highest rates of religious conservatism and abstinence-only programming show the highest teen pregnancy rates within the US. This is the data. The relationship between sexual shame and worse sexual health outcomes is not a liberal talking point; it is a consistent finding in the public health literature.

The paradox of repression: what happens when desire is forbidden

Sexual desire doesn’t disappear when it’s forbidden. It moves underground. And underground desire, cut off from education, community context, and honest self-examination, finds outlets that are often more harmful than the sanctioned expression would have been.

The specific pathology of shame-based sexuality includes: the double standard (men’s sexuality permitted, women’s controlled, producing a culture of secrecy and exploitation); the escalation effect (forbidden things are more compelling, not less, as the psychology of taboo is well-established in the marketing literature); and the specific form of sexual dysfunction that emerges from the combination of high desire and intense shame — the person who wants desperately and cannot allow themselves to want, producing the specific psychological profile of the sexual hypocrite who condemns publicly and acts privately.

The data on sexual violence in ultra-conservative societies is sobering. Societies with the most severe restrictions on female sexuality and the most shame-based sexual culture do not show lower rates of sexual violence against women. They often show higher rates — partly because restricted women have fewer resources to report or resist assault, partly because the absence of legitimate sexual outlet creates a culture where illegitimate outlet is sought.

The uncontrolled dimension: what happens at the other extreme

Intellectual honesty requires acknowledging that the failure mode of sexual restriction is not the only failure mode. The failure mode of entirely uncontrolled sexuality is also real and also documented.

The proliferation of accessible, extreme internet pornography — free, high-definition, and increasingly algorithmically optimised for maximum dopamine activation — constitutes a mass neurological experiment on human sexuality whose consequences are becoming clearer. Heavy pornography use produces measurable changes in prefrontal cortex connectivity, dopamine receptor density, and partnered sexual function. The rate of sexual dysfunction in young men, historically low, has risen significantly in cohorts exposed to high-frequency pornography from adolescence. This is not a moral argument. It is neuroscience.

The commodification of sex — the treatment of sexual access as a consumer product with a price, separate from any relational context — produces its own psychological consequences. Not because sex-for-payment is inherently wrong, but because the psychological model of sexuality as transaction rather than connection shapes how the consumer relates to sexual partners more broadly. The boundaries between these categories, never sharp, become progressively blurred.

The honest position: neither shame nor licence produces healthy sexuality. The societies that produce the best sexual health outcomes are the ones that treat sexuality as a subject deserving of genuine education, cultural maturity, and honest engagement — neither forbidden nor trivialised.

8. The Real Effects of Sexuality on Individuals — Biology, Psychology, and the Heart

What does sex actually do to the body, mind, and heart of the person who experiences it? Not in the cultural or social sense, but in the most directly personal and biological sense.

Biology: the hormonal cascade of sexual activity

Sexual activity produces a specific hormonal cascade that has measurable effects on the body. Testosterone — the primary driver of sexual motivation in both men and women, though present at approximately 10-20 times higher levels in men — rises in anticipation of sexual activity and in response to sexual contact. It promotes aggressive pursuit of desired outcomes, risk tolerance, and physical energy, which explains why sexual motivation drives so much human behaviour beyond sex itself: competition, creativity, achievement.

Oxytocin — sometimes called the ‘bonding hormone,’ though its functions are more complex than this label implies — is released during sexual activity, particularly at orgasm, in both sexes. It produces feelings of warmth, trust, and attachment to the partner in whose presence it’s released. Oxytocin is also released during breastfeeding, childbirth, and sustained physical contact. Romantic love, evolutionary theory suggests, co-opted the mother-infant bonding system — using the same neurochemistry that bonds mother to infant to bond sexual partners to each other.

Vasopressin, released primarily in men during sexual activity, promotes mate-guarding behaviour — the specific motivation to protect and maintain exclusive access to a sexual partner. In prairie voles, the distribution of vasopressin receptors in the brain determines whether the vole is monogamous or promiscuous: the same gene, different receptor distribution, entirely different mating system. The human research shows that vasopressin receptor gene variation is associated with differences in pair-bonding behaviour.

Prolactin, released at orgasm in both sexes, produces the post-coital refractory period, the satisfaction and relaxation that follows sexual completion. Its effects are significantly different between men (longer refractory period, higher prolactin) and women (shorter refractory period, lower prolactin) — a biological asymmetry that has social consequences.

The immune system effects of regular sexual activity are documented: people who have sex once or twice a week show higher levels of salivary immunoglobulin A (IgA) than those who have sex less frequently or not at all. Sexual partners share microbiome composition over time — couples who have regular sexual contact show progressively more similar gut microbiome profiles, a finding whose health implications are beginning to be explored.

Psychology: attachment, jealousy, and the architecture of sexual relationships

John Bowlby’s attachment theory and Mary Ainsworth’s extension of it into adult relationships through the ‘Strange Situation’ work of the 1970s established that human beings develop a characteristic style of attachment in infancy that persists, with modification, throughout adult life. Secure attachment (characterised by trust in the availability and responsiveness of significant others), anxious attachment (characterised by hypervigilance to signs of abandonment and difficulty self-regulating in the face of relationship uncertainty), and avoidant attachment (characterised by suppression of attachment needs and distancing behaviour when intimacy is threatened) manifest distinctively in sexual relationships.

Anxious attachment tends to produce sexual preoccupation — using sex as a mechanism for emotional reassurance and security rather than for pleasure or connection, resulting in a specific pattern of wanting more sexual contact than the partner and interpreting any reduction in sexual frequency as evidence of abandonment. Avoidant attachment tends to produce discomfort with the emotional intimacy that sexual contact produces, leading to patterns of sexual engagement followed by distancing.

Jealousy deserves its own analysis. It is an evolved mate-guarding mechanism: the emotional and behavioural system that motivates protection of an exclusive sexual bond against real or perceived competitors. David Buss’s cross-cultural research documented its universal presence across 37 cultures, with the specific finding that men and women show different patterns of jealousy distress: men are more distressed by sexual infidelity (which threatens paternity certainty), women are more distressed by emotional infidelity (which threatens the male investment that female and offspring survival depends on). This sex difference is consistent with the evolutionary logic of paternity certainty and parental investment.

The emotional reality: what love does to the person who feels it

Helen Fisher’s research extended to people who had been rejected in romantic relationships. The fMRI scans showed activation in the ventral tegmental area (the reward circuit that wanted the beloved), the insular cortex (associated with physical pain and the subjective experience of suffering), and the anterior cingulate cortex (associated with social pain and the awareness of loss). Romantic rejection is, neurologically, a form of physical pain. The English expression ‘heartbreak’ is not metaphor. It corresponds to a specific pattern of neural activation that includes the regions responsible for the experience of physical hurt.

The grief of ending a pair bond has no clear parallel in any other primate species at the same level of intensity and duration. Humans grieve lost loves with the same neurological profile as any other form of profound loss. The capacity for this grief is inseparable from the capacity for the love that precedes it: the depth of the attachment determines the depth of its loss. This is not a flaw in human psychology. It is the price of the bond’s value.

Sexual trauma deserves specific acknowledgment. Early sexual trauma — abuse, assault, exploitation in childhood or adolescence — produces specific neurobiological changes: amygdala hyperreactivity (heightened threat response), HPA axis dysregulation (cortisol response patterns that don’t match actual threat levels), and altered neural processing of sexual stimuli that can create lasting difficulties with intimacy, trust, and the capacity to experience sexuality as pleasurable rather than threatening. The psychological consequences of sexual trauma are not a matter of insufficient willpower or inadequate character. They are the predictable neurobiological consequences of a profound boundary violation in a domain that the nervous system treats as among the most significant in human life.

9. The Future of Desire — What Happens When Sex and Reproduction Completely Separate

The contraceptive revolution has already begun separating sex from reproduction for the majority of people in the developed world. But the next generation of technological changes will complete that separation in ways that will challenge every assumption the evolutionary history of desire was built upon.

Ectogenesis: when reproduction doesn’t require a body

Ectogenesis — the development of a fetus outside the human body, in an artificial womb — is not science fiction. Partial ectogenesis is already clinical reality: premature infants born as early as 22-23 weeks gestation are regularly maintained in neonatal intensive care units that provide many of the functions a uterus performs. Full ectogenesis, in which the entire gestational process occurs outside a human body, is in active research development. Some bioethicists estimate full ectogenesis is 20-30 years from clinical application.

When reproduction is entirely possible without a woman’s body, the evolutionary pressures that shaped human sexuality change fundamentally. The pair bond evolved partly to ensure that a male would invest in child-rearing: the female needed the male’s resources during the energy-intensive pregnancy and infant-care phases, and the male needed the female’s exclusive sexual access to ensure his investment was in his genetic offspring. If neither of these dependencies is necessary — if anyone can grow a child without either sex or gestation — the entire social architecture of pair bonding, marriage, and family structure built on reproductive biology loses its biological foundation.

What will desire be for, when reproduction is entirely optional? The Indian tradition’s answer is, unexpectedly, the most useful here: desire has always been more than reproductive. Kama is a Purushartha — a life goal that has its own intrinsic value. The erotic, the relational, the connective, the transcendent dimensions of sexuality exist independently of its reproductive function. When reproduction is fully separated, these dimensions may become more visible, not less.

AI companions: the test of what desire is really for

Japan has documented what every other developed nation is beginning to experience: significant numbers of people forming primary emotional and in some cases explicitly sexual bonds with AI systems and companion robots. This is not a fringe phenomenon. Japanese census data has tracked steady declines in marriage rates, sexual activity rates, and birthrates alongside the rise of what sociologists call ‘herbivore men’ and ‘celibate women’ who have withdrawn from the social complexity of human sexual relationship in favour of digital alternatives.

The question this raises is not primarily moral. It’s anthropological: if AI systems can satisfy the companionship, emotional resonance, and even sexual stimulation needs that human relationships have historically fulfilled, what is the irreducibly human quality of sexual connection that AI cannot provide? The honest answer may be: the specific vulnerability, the specific risk, the specific possibility of loss and grief and genuine surprise that only another conscious being can offer. AI can mimic presence but cannot offer genuine otherness — the actual encounter with a consciousness genuinely different from your own that is the deepest dimension of what desire seeks.

The Upanishadic framing is useful here: consciousness reaches toward itself across the illusion of separation. AI is not genuinely other. It is an extension of the user’s own desires, reflected back with artificial warmth. The deepest need desire serves — the recognition of the self in what is genuinely not-self — cannot be met by a system that has no self to recognise.

The adolescent brain and pornography: the most urgent question of our time

The most significant sexual public health challenge of the 21st century is not the one that most people are discussing. It is this: for the first time in evolutionary history, millions of young people are having their sexual psychology formed by pornography before they have any experience of real human sexual relationship.

The adolescent brain, in active neurological development through the early 20s, is significantly more susceptible to reward circuit conditioning than the mature adult brain. The pornography that an adolescent encounters — typically free, immediately accessible, algorithmically optimised for escalating stimulation — is conditioning their dopamine wanting circuits at the most neuroplastic period of their development. What they will want sexually as adults is being shaped by what they watched at 13.

The specific consequences documented in clinical populations of heavy adolescent pornography users: escalating tolerance requiring more extreme material, difficulty experiencing arousal with real partners who cannot match pornographic stimuli, performance anxiety in partnered sex, and in some cases what clinicians call ‘porn-induced erectile dysfunction’ — the inability to achieve arousal with a real partner that disappears in the presence of pornographic material. These are not moral failures. They are the entirely predictable neurological consequences of the supernormal stimulus problem applied to the developing brain.

Q1. Why did sex evolve when asexual reproduction is more efficient?

The two-fold cost of sex — measured at precisely 2.14x in real outdoor populations across four breeding seasons — means sexual reproduction is objectively almost twice as expensive as asexual reproduction in reproductive efficiency terms. Yet sex persists in 99% of eukaryotic species. The most compelling current explanation is the Red Queen hypothesis: parasites cannot crack a constantly shuffling genetic deck. A clonal population gives parasites a fixed target; once they evolve to penetrate one individual’s defences, they can penetrate everyone’s. A sexual population reshuffles the genetic combination with every generation, constantly changing the locks. Ebert’s 2025 review in the Annual Review of Genetics confirmed that Red Queen dynamics are visible across timescales from days to millions of years. Sex also purges deleterious mutations more effectively than asexual reproduction, and facilitates adaptation to rapidly changing environments. The Red Queen is the strongest single explanation, but most evolutionary biologists consider the maintenance of sex to be multi-factorial. The honest answer: we understand a great deal about why sex persists; we don’t have a single definitive answer that closes the debate.
